Rusedski powers through, but Henman heads home

Greg Rusedski believes his hard work in training is about to pay off as he closes in on taking over the British number one spot from Tim Henman.

Henman last night crashed out of the BA-CA Trophy in Vienna when he was beaten 6-7 (2/7) 7/6 (7/3) 6-1 by Czech third seed Radek Stepanek.
